A beautiful Cushion Mirror with Quality Bevel Cut Mirror Panels and two tiny platform bracketed shelves for standing a pair of candlesticks on.

The plasterwork is in very good condition throughout but as usual the gilt finish has been refreshed afew times over the last 100 years.

The mirror silvering is in excellent order on all inset panels,with no speckling being seen.

A cushion mirror features a raised central glass panel surrounded by angled or sloped outer mirrored sections, creating a three-dimensional frame profile that was popular during the 17th to 19th centuries across Western Europe.

These frames were typically crafted from softwood structures coated with gesso and plaster detailing, finished with hand-applied gold leaf gilding, and fitted with bevelled mercury or silvered glass plates.

Authentic pieces exhibit signs of natural wear to the gold leaf, revealing red or grey bole and white gesso underneath, along with dark spots or oxidisation on the original bevelled glass plates.

Position the mirror centrally above a fireplace mantelpiece or hallway console table to reflect natural light and create a formal architectural focal point within contemporary or traditional rooms.

Dust the gilded frame gently using a soft, dry bristle brush to prevent lifting the fragile gold leaf, and clean the mirror glass with a slightly dampened microfibre cloth, keeping moisture away from the frame edge.
